To learn more about us, visit www.impact-advisors.com Job Overview Impact Advisors is seeking a dynamic and motivated Patient Financial Services (PFS) Manager who will serve as a senior revenue cycle leader responsible for overseeing back-end revenue cycle operations across a single or multiple client engagements. This role requires a strong operational mindset and the ability to lead high-performing teams across U.S.-based and nearshore environments, while also actively engaging in the day-to-day work. The ideal candidate is a hands-on, “player-coach” leader who is comfortable stepping in to work billing edits, AR accounts, and denials while simultaneously driving team performance and client outcomes. The PFS Manager serves as the operational lead for client delivery, ensuring strong partnerships, improved revenue performance, consistent KPI achievement, and continuous optimization of both billing and accounts receivable workflows. This leader oversees all back-office functions—including billing, cash posting alignment, follow-up, denial management, and AR resolution—and manages supervisors, representatives, and third-party teams. This position reports to the VP of Central Operations and offers a unique opportunity to contribute to client success while making a meaningful impact on the healthcare industry. Key Responsibilities: Team Leadership & Management Lead and oversee a multi-layered PFS team including Supervisors, U.S.-based Representatives, Nearshore Teams, and third-party partners Act as a hands-on leader, stepping in to work complex billing issues, AR accounts, denial scenarios, and escalations as needed Provide side-by-side coaching and live account reviews to reinforce best practices in billing, follow-up, and denial resolution Lead live and structured training sessions on billing workflows, payer requirements, and AR follow-up strategies Partner with Training and QA teams to identify skill gaps and directly intervene with targeted, hands-on coaching Ensure frontline staff consistently demonstrate correct workflows across both billing and AR, not just meet productivity expectations Collaborate with workforce planning to ensure proper staffing, onboarding, and ongoing competency development Operations Oversight Maintain close visibility into daily billing and AR work queues, intervening directly to resolve issues and ensure timely throughput Ensure leadership decisions are grounded in firsthand knowledge of account-level challenges and system workflows Own performance across end-to-end back-office functions, including: Charge review and claim submission Billing edits and rework AR follow-up and collections Denial management and appeals Underpayment resolution and variance analysis Build and drive performance against KPIs including cash collections, billing accuracy and timeliness, first-pass resolution rates, denial rates and overturn rates, and AR aging and productivity metrics. Monitor AR aging and billing backlog trends; implement targeted strategies to reduce Days in AR (DAR) and improve clean claim rates Drive end-to-end process accountability, ensuring seamless flow from billing through final resolution Reporting & Analytics Use data and reporting to assess risks, identify performance gaps, and take immediate corrective action Analyze billing defects, denial trends, and payer behavior to drive upstream and downstream improvements Partner with teams to implement system edits, workqueue logic, and automation opportunities Cross-Functional Collaboration Develop or support SOPs, process maps, and standardized workflows to ensure consistency across both US and Nearshore operations Partner with internal and client teams to streamline processes, remove bottlenecks, and enhance efficiency through automation and system optimization.
